My T.V. has 4 options for color: Standard, Vivid, Cinematic, and User.
For DotD (I have the PS3 version, and I'm using an HDMI cable and HDTV if it makes any difference) Cinematic really helps tone everything down. Standard is, well, the regular brightness, User is too bright, and Vivid is WAAAAY too bright. So, on your TV, there should be some sort of Picture setting. Try messing with that to change it around.
